Python Desktop Application Developer

2 weeks ago


Coimbatore, India Capgemini Engineering Full time

Python Desktop Application Developer Location: PAN India Preferred Location: Coimbatore Choosing this role means joining a team dedicated to building robust desktop applications for device control and data visualization. You’ll work on Python-based GUI development, custom communication protocols, and real-time data integration to deliver high-quality solutions for embedded systems. Your Role As a Python Desktop Application Developer , you will design and implement rich desktop interfaces, integrate real-time data streams, and ensure seamless communication with devices using custom serial protocols. You’ll collaborate with firmware teams to maintain protocol compatibility and deliver responsive, user-friendly applications. In this role, you will: Develop desktop GUIs using frameworks like PyQt, Tkinter, or wxPython. Work in Windows environments, leveraging Windows APIs and packaging tools (PyInstaller) for deployment. Design and implement custom communication protocols over serial (RS-232/RS-485/USB). Use libraries like pySerial for device communication. Integrate real-time data streams into GUI and create visualizations using Matplotlib, PyQtGraph, or similar. Perform testing and debugging with protocol analyzers and serial communication tools. Ensure responsive UI through multithreading during data exchange. Your Profile Strong experience in Python GUI development (PyQt, Tkinter, wxPython). Expertise in Windows environment and deployment best practices. Proficiency in custom serial protocols and pySerial. Knowledge of data visualization tools (Matplotlib, PyQtGraph). Familiarity with multithreading for responsive UI. Preferred: Experience developing control panels or device configuration tools for embedded systems and collaborating with firmware teams. Soft Skills Strong problem-solving and analytical skills. Ability to work collaboratively with cross-functional teams. About Us At Capgemini Engineering, the world leader in engineering services, we bring together a global team of engineers, scientists, and architects to help the world’s most innovative companies unleash their potential. From autonomous cars to life-saving robots, our digital and software technology experts think outside the box as they provide unique R&D and engineering services across all industries. Join us for a career full of opportunities. Where you can make a difference. Where no two days are the same.



  • Coimbatore, India Capgemini Engineering Full time

    Python Desktop Application DeveloperLocation: PAN IndiaPreferred Location: CoimbatoreChoosing this role means joining a team dedicated to building robust desktop applications for device control and data visualization. You’ll work on Python-based GUI development, custom communication protocols, and real-time data integration to deliver high-quality...


  • Coimbatore, India Capgemini Engineering Full time

    Python Desktop Application DeveloperLocation: PAN IndiaPreferred Location: CoimbatoreChoosing this role means joining a team dedicated to building robust desktop applications for device control and data visualization. You’ll work on Python-based GUI development, custom communication protocols, and real-time data integration to deliver high-quality...


  • Coimbatore, India Capgemini Engineering Full time

    Python Desktop Application DeveloperLocation: PAN IndiaPreferred Location: CoimbatoreChoosing this role means joining a team dedicated to building robust desktop applications for device control and data visualization. You’ll work on Python-based GUI development, custom communication protocols, and real-time data integration to deliver high-quality...


  • Coimbatore, India Capgemini Engineering Full time

    Python Desktop Application DeveloperLocation: PAN IndiaPreferred Location: CoimbatoreChoosing this role means joining a team dedicated to building robust desktop applications for device control and data visualization. You’ll work on Python-based GUI development, custom communication protocols, and real-time data integration to deliver high-quality...


  • Coimbatore, India Jobted IN C2 Full time

    At Capgemini Engineering, the world leader in engineering services, we bring together a global team of engineers, scientists, and architects to help the world’s most innovative companies unleash their potential. From autonomous cars to life-saving robots, our digital and software technology experts think outside the box as they provide unique R&D and...

  • Python Developer

    4 days ago


    Coimbatore, Tamil Nadu, India -c108-4b6e-8431-86e87109195e Full time

    We are looking for an experienced Python developer to join our engineering team and help us create dynamic software applications for our clients. In this role, you will be responsible for writing and testing scalable code, developing back-end components, and integrating user-facing elements in collaboration with front-end developers.To be successful as a...

  • Python Developer

    2 days ago


    Coimbatore, Tamil Nadu, India Ultrafly Solutions Private Limited Full time

    Job Title: Python Developer (13 Years Experience)Job SummaryWe are looking for a motivated Python Developer with 13 years of hands-on experience to join our development team. The ideal candidate will be responsible for building scalable applications, writing clean and efficient code, and collaborating with cross-functional teams to deliver high-quality...

  • Python Developer

    4 weeks ago


    Coimbatore, India goML Full time

    We are in search of a passionate and skilled Python Developer to join our dynamic team. This role is ideal for someone with a profound expertise in Python and its ecosystem, focused on backend development, API design, and system integration. Candidate Experience - 3+ Years Technologies - Python, FastAPI, Django, Flask, SQL/NoSQL, Docker, AWS, CI/CD...

  • Python Developer

    4 weeks ago


    Coimbatore, India Megovation Full time

    Job Title: Python DeveloperLocation: Tamilnadu, IndiaLocation Preference: We are specifically looking to hire talented individuals from Tier 2 and Tier 3 cities for this opportunity.Employment Type: Full-timeCompany Description:We build big data products, application development, and ERP implementations on the public cloud. Our 200+ years technology...


  • coimbatore, India beBeebackend Full time

    Backend Development OpportunityWe are seeking a highly skilled Python developer to join our team as we build high-performance backend systems.Design and develop scalable APIs, microservices, and cloud-backed applications using Python.Translate business requirements into robust, maintainable backend solutions.Write clean, reusable code adhering to best...